Configuration de la paie Odoo HR par pays : guide de configuration complet

Guide étape par étape pour configurer Odoo HR Payroll pour différents pays, y compris les règles fiscales, la sécurité sociale, les déductions et les rapports statutaires.

E
ECOSIRE Research and Development Team
|16 mars 202611 min de lecture2.5k Mots|

Fait partie de notre série Compliance & Regulation

Lire le guide complet

Configuration de la paie Odoo HR par pays : guide de configuration complet

La paie est le module le plus spécifique à un pays dans tout système ERP. Les tranches d’imposition, les cotisations de sécurité sociale, les régimes de retraite et les exigences légales en matière de déclaration varient considérablement d’une juridiction à l’autre. Le module de paie d'Odoo résout ce problème grâce à un cadre de localisation qui fournit des règles salariales, des tables d'impôt et des modèles de rapports spécifiques au pays. Ce guide décrit le processus de configuration pour les principales régions et les options de personnalisation pour les pays sans localisation officielle.

Points clés à retenir

  • Odoo 19 est livré avec des localisations de paie pour plus de 40 pays couvrant les règles salariales, les tables d'impôts et les rapports statutaires
  • Le moteur de règles salariales utilise des expressions Python pour des calculs complexes tout en conservant une piste d'audit complète
  • Les organisations multi-pays peuvent gérer la paie pour différentes juridictions à partir d'une seule instance Odoo
  • Des localisations personnalisées peuvent être créées à l'aide du cadre de structure salariale pour les pays non officiellement pris en charge
  • L'intégration avec la comptabilité garantit que les écritures du journal de paie sont automatiquement publiées avec un mappage de compte correct.

Présentation de l'architecture de la paie

Odoo Payroll traite les calculs de salaire via un moteur basé sur des règles. L'architecture se compose de :

Structures salariales : modèles qui définissent les règles salariales qui s'appliquent à une catégorie d'employés. Une entreprise peut avoir des structures pour les salariés mensuels, les travailleurs horaires et les sous-traitants.

Règles salariales : Étapes de calcul individuelles au sein d'une structure. Chaque règle possède une expression Python qui calcule sa valeur en fonction d'entrées telles que le salaire de base, les jours travaillés et les résultats des règles précédentes. Les règles s'exécutent dans l'ordre en fonction de leur numéro de priorité.

Catégories de règles salariales : groupes qui organisent les règles de reporting. Les catégories comprennent le salaire brut, les déductions, les cotisations patronales et le salaire net.

Fiche de paie : le document de sortie pour un seul employé pour une seule période, contenant toutes les valeurs de règle calculées.

Accédez à Paie > Configuration > Structures salariales pour afficher et modifier les structures salariales disponibles dans votre instance Odoo.

Configuration aux États-Unis

Configuration de la taxe fédérale

La paie américaine nécessite de configurer la retenue d'impôt fédéral sur le revenu en fonction du formulaire W-4 de l'employé :

  1. Accédez à Paie > Configuration > Règles de salaire et localisez la règle de l'impôt fédéral sur le revenu.
  2. La règle fait référence aux tranches d'imposition actuelles de l'IRS, qu'Odoo met à jour chaque année.
  3. Le contrat de chaque employé enregistre son statut de déclaration (célibataire, marié déclarant conjointement, chef de famille) et ses allocations.
  4. Le calcul prend en compte les déductions avant impôts (401k, assurance maladie, FSA) avant de calculer le revenu imposable

Configuration des taxes d'État

L'impôt sur le revenu des États nécessite des règles supplémentaires pour chaque État où travaillent les employés :

Catégorie d'ÉtatExemplesApproche de configuration
Pas d'impôt sur le revenuTX, FL, WA, NV, NH, TN, WY, SD, AKAucune règle supplémentaire n'est nécessaire
Tarif forfaitaireIL (4,95%), PA (3,07%), IN (3,05%)Règle unique avec pourcentage fixe
Parenthèses progressivesCalifornie, New York, New Jersey ou ORRègle multi-supports similaire à celle fédérale
Taxes localesNew York, Philadelphie, DétroitRègles supplémentaires par localité

FICA et Medicare

La sécurité sociale (6,2 % jusqu'à la base salariale) et Medicare (1,45 % avec 0,9 % supplémentaire au-dessus de 200 000 USD) sont configurées comme des règles de cotisations des employeurs et des salariés. La limite de la base salariale est mise à jour chaque année --- pour 2026, configurez la base salariale de la sécurité sociale dans Paie > Configuration > Paramètres.

Avantages et déductions

Déductions américaines courantes configurées comme règles salariales :

  • 401(k) : Déduction avant impôt avec contrepartie de l'employeur (pourcentage et plafond configurables)
  • Assurance maladie : Part des primes des salariés (avant impôts selon l'article 125)
  • HSA/FSA : contributions avant impôts à des comptes d'épargne santé ou à des comptes de dépenses flexibles
  • Roth 401(k) : Déduction après impôt (réduit le salaire net mais pas le revenu imposable)
  • Saisies-arrêts : retenues judiciaires avec règles de priorité

Pays de l'Union européenne

Allemagne

La masse salariale allemande est parmi les plus complexes en raison de l'impôt ecclésiastique, de la surtaxe de solidarité et de l'interaction entre les cotisations de sécurité sociale :

Les classes d'impôt (Steuerklasse I à VI) déterminent la retenue à la source de l'impôt sur le revenu. Configurez la classe fiscale de chaque employé sur son contrat dans Paie > Employés > Contrats.

Les cotisations de sécurité sociale en Allemagne sont réparties à parts égales entre l'employeur et l'employé :

CotisationTarif employéTarif employeurPlafond (2026)
Assurance maladie7,3% + supplément7,3% + supplément62 100 EUR/an
Assurance pension9,3%9,3%90 600 EUR/an (Ouest)
Assurance chômage1,3%1,3%90 600 EUR/an
Soins de longue durée1,7% (+ 0,6% sans enfant)1,7%62 100 EUR/an

Impôt ecclésiastique : 8% ou 9% de l'impôt sur le revenu selon l'État fédéral (Bundesland).

France

La paie française utilise la DSN (Déclaration Sociale Nominative) pour la déclaration électronique aux organismes de sécurité sociale. Domaines de configuration clés :

  • Cotisations sociales : Plus de 30 lignes de cotisations sociales individuelles couvrant la santé, la retraite, le chômage et la retraite complémentaire
  • CSG/CRDS : Taxes de cotisations sociales calculées sur 98,25% du salaire brut
  • Mutuelle : Complémentaire santé obligatoire (l'employeur paie minimum 50%)
  • Prévoyance : Cotisations d'assurance décès et invalidité
  • Réduction Fillon : Réduction patronale de la Sécurité sociale pour les salaires proches du Smic

Royaume-Uni

La paie au Royaume-Uni suit le système PAYE (Pay As You Earn) :

Codes fiscaux : codes attribués par le HMRC qui déterminent l'allocation non imposable (par exemple, 1257L pour l'allocation personnelle standard)

  • Assurance Nationale : Cotisations NI des salariés à 8 % (au-dessus du seuil primaire) et NI de l'employeur à 13,8 % (au-dessus du seuil secondaire)
  • Déductions pour prêts étudiants : taux Plan 1, Plan 2, Plan 4 ou Postgraduate
  • Inscription automatique à la pension : Pension d'employeur au minimum 5 % employé + 3 % employeur
  • Rapports RTI : soumissions d'informations en temps réel au HMRC après chaque cycle de paie

Moyen-Orient et Afrique

Émirats arabes unis

La paie aux Émirats arabes unis est plus simple en raison de l’absence d’impôt sur le revenu, mais nécessite une attention particulière aux points suivants :

  • Calcul de la gratification : gratification de fin de service basée sur les années de service (21 jours/an pendant les 5 premières années, 30 jours/an par la suite)
  • Conformité WPS : transferts de salaires électroniques du système de protection des salaires via des banques agréées
  • DEWS : Plan d'Épargne Professionnelle Difc pour les entreprises basées au DIFC
  • Allocation de logement : généralement 30 à 40 % du salaire de base, configurée comme règle salariale

Arabie Saoudite

  • GOSI : Organisme Général de Cotisations de Sécurité Sociale (employeur 12%, salarié 10% pour les Saoudiens ; employeur 2% pour les expatriés)
  • Pas d'impôt sur le revenu : Pour les particuliers (l'impôt sur les sociétés s'applique aux entités étrangères)
  • Saudisation : suivi des pourcentages de nationalité pour vérifier le respect du programme Nitaqat

Afrique du Sud

  • PAYE : tranches d'imposition progressives administrées par le SRAS
  • UIF : Caisse d'Assurance Chômage (1% salarié + 1% employeur, plafonné)
  • SDL : Prélèvement pour le Développement des Compétences (1% de la masse salariale)
  • Crédits d'impôt pour soins médicaux : crédits mensuels fixes par personne à charge

Asie-Pacifique

Inde

La paie indienne comporte plusieurs éléments :

ComposantDescriptifPourcentage typique
De baseComposante du salaire de base40 à 50 % du CTC
HRAAllocation de loyer pour la maison40 à 50 % du tarif de base
DAAllocation de chertéVarie selon le secteur
Allocation spécialeComposant flexibleSolde du CTC
PFCaisse de prévoyance (employé)12% de base
PFCaisse de prévoyance (employeur)12 % de base (3,67 % EPF + 8,33 % BPA)
ESIAssurance d'État des employés0,75% salarié + 3,25% employeur
Taxe ProfessionnelleTaxe au niveau de l'ÉtatVarie selon l'État (max 2 500 INR/an)

TDS (impôt retenu à la source) : l'employeur calcule et déduit mensuellement l'impôt sur le revenu en fonction des investissements déclarés et du régime fiscal applicable (ancien ou nouveau).

Australie

  • Retenue à la source PAYG : impôt sur le revenu Pay As You Go à l'aide des tables d'impôt ATO
  • Retraite : Cotisation de retraite obligatoire de l'employeur (11,5% pour 2026)
  • HECS-HELP : remboursements de prêts d'études supérieures au-dessus du seuil de revenus
  • Medicare Levy : 2 % du revenu imposable (avec supplément pour les revenus plus élevés sans assurance maladie privée)
  • Rapports STP : paie en une seule touche vers ATO à chaque événement de paie

Création de localisations personnalisées

Pour les pays sans localisation officielle d'Odoo, vous pouvez créer des structures salariales personnalisées :

Étape 1 : Définir la structure salariale

Créez une nouvelle structure salariale dans Paie > Configuration > Structures salariales avec des règles couvrant :

  • Calcul du salaire brut
  • Règles de retenue d'impôt (référence aux tranches d'imposition du pays)
  • Cotisations sociales (parts salariale et patronale)
  • Déductions légales (pension, assurance, etc.)
  • Calcul du salaire net

Étape 2 : Créer des règles salariales

Chaque règle salariale requiert :

  • Nom et code : Nom descriptif et code de référence unique
  • Catégorie : Brut, déduction, cotisation employeur ou net
  • Séquence : Ordre d'exécution (les nombres inférieurs s'exécutent en premier)
  • Expression Python : La logique de calcul

Exemple de règle pour un calcul d'impôt progressif :

La condition Python vérifie que le total de la catégorie pour le salaire brut est supérieur à zéro. L'expression de calcul fait référence aux seuils et aux taux des tranches d'imposition pour le pays spécifique, en appliquant des taux marginaux à chaque tranche. L'objet payslip donne accès à tous les résultats des règles précédentes et aux données des contrats des employés.

Étape 3 : Configurer les rapports statutaires

Créez des modèles de rapports à l'aide du moteur de reporting QWeb d'Odoo pour les rapports spécifiques à un pays tels que les certificats fiscaux, les déclarations de sécurité sociale et les résumés de fin d'année.

Opérations de paie multi-pays

Les organisations opérant dans plusieurs pays peuvent gérer toute la paie à partir d’une seule instance Odoo :

  1. Créer des structures salariales pour chaque pays
  2. Attribuer des structures aux contrats des employés en fonction de leur lieu de travail
  3. Configurez la comptabilité avec des écritures de journal distinctes par pays pour une comptabilisation correcte dans le GLG
  4. Définissez les périodes de paie par pays (mensuel est la norme dans la plupart des pays ; bihebdomadaire aux États-Unis)
  5. Générer des rapports spécifiques à un pays à l'aide de modèles de rapports localisés

La fonctionnalité multi-sociétés d'Odoo prend en charge des entités juridiques distinctes par pays tout en conservant des rapports consolidés au niveau du groupe.

Intégration de la paie avec la comptabilité

Chaque lot de fiches de paie génère des écritures de journal qui sont enregistrées dans le grand livre. Le mappage des comptes est configuré par règle salariale :

  • Comptes de charges salariales : Écritures au débit du salaire brut, des cotisations patronales
  • Comptes de passif : écritures de crédit pour retenue à la source, cotisations sociales à payer
  • Compte bancaire : Crédit pour paiement du salaire net

Accédez à Paie > Configuration > Règles de salaire et modifiez chaque règle pour définir les comptes de débit et de crédit. L'écriture au journal est créée lors de la validation du lot de fiches de paie et peut être revue avant comptabilisation.

Services de Paie ECOSIRE

Configurer correctement la paie nécessite une connaissance approfondie à la fois de l'architecture technique d'Odoo et du droit du travail local. Les services de mise en œuvre Odoo d'ECOSIRE incluent des spécialistes de la paie qui configurent les localisations spécifiques au pays, créent des règles salariales personnalisées et valident les calculs par rapport aux enregistrements de paie manuels. Nos services d'assistance incluent des mises à jour annuelles sur les changements de tranche d'imposition et les modifications réglementaires.

Lecture connexe

À quelle fréquence les localisations de paie Odoo sont-elles mises à jour pour les modifications fiscales ?

Les localisations officielles d'Odoo sont mises à jour au moins une fois par an pour refléter les nouvelles tranches d'imposition, les plafonds de sécurité sociale et les changements réglementaires. Pour les clients Entreprise, ces mises à jour sont incluses dans l’abonnement de maintenance et arrivent généralement avant le début du nouvel exercice. Les localisations personnalisées doivent être mises à jour manuellement.

Odoo peut-il gérer la paie des employés salariés et horaires ?

Oui. Créez des structures salariales distinctes pour les employés salariés et horaires. Les structures horaires font référence au module de présence ou aux entrées de la feuille de temps pour calculer les heures travaillées, puis appliquent des taux horaires avec des multiplicateurs d'heures supplémentaires basés sur les exigences du droit du travail local.

La paie Odoo est-elle certifiée conforme aux réglementations dans tous les pays pris en charge ?

La certification varie selon les pays. Certaines localisations (France, Belgique, Afrique du Sud) ont été certifiées ou validées par les autorités locales. D'autres sont basés sur les règles et taux fiscaux publiés mais peuvent ne pas être certifiés officiellement. Vérifiez toujours les calculs de paie par rapport à des sources indépendantes lors de la configuration initiale.

E

Rédigé par

ECOSIRE Research and Development Team

Création de produits numériques de niveau entreprise chez ECOSIRE. Partage d'analyses sur les intégrations Odoo, l'automatisation e-commerce et les solutions d'entreprise propulsées par l'IA.

Plus de Compliance & Regulation

Liste de contrôle pour la préparation d'un audit : comment votre ERP rend les audits 60 % plus rapides

Compléter la liste de contrôle de préparation à l’audit à l’aide des systèmes ERP. Réduisez le temps d’audit de 60 % grâce à une documentation, des contrôles et une collecte automatisée de preuves appropriés.

Guide de mise en œuvre du consentement aux cookies : gestion du consentement conforme à la loi

Mettez en œuvre un consentement aux cookies conforme au RGPD, à l'ePrivacy, au CCPA et aux réglementations mondiales. Couvre les bannières de consentement, la catégorisation des cookies et l'intégration CMP.

Réglementation sur le transfert de données transfrontalier : naviguer dans les flux de données internationaux

Parcourez les réglementations en matière de transfert de données transfrontalier avec les SCC, les décisions d'adéquation, les BCR et les évaluations d'impact des transferts pour la conformité au RGPD, au Royaume-Uni et à l'APAC.

Exigences réglementaires en matière de cybersécurité par région : une carte de conformité pour les entreprises mondiales

Parcourez les réglementations en matière de cybersécurité aux États-Unis, dans l’UE, au Royaume-Uni, dans la région APAC et au Moyen-Orient. Couvre les règles NIS2, DORA, SEC, les exigences en matière d'infrastructure critique et les délais de conformité.

Gouvernance et conformité des données : le guide complet pour les entreprises technologiques

Guide complet de gouvernance des données couvrant les cadres de conformité, la classification des données, les politiques de conservation, les réglementations en matière de confidentialité et les feuilles de route de mise en œuvre pour les entreprises technologiques.

Politiques de conservation des données et automatisation : conservez ce dont vous avez besoin, supprimez ce dont vous avez besoin

Créez des politiques de conservation des données avec des exigences légales, des calendriers de conservation, une application automatisée et une vérification de la conformité au RGPD, SOX et HIPAA.

Discutez sur WhatsApp